fishing shadow lake middletown- what baits/lures to use
 
hello, i just started fishin shadow lake by canoe,

what are the some good lures/live bait to use

mainly a salt fisherman here

thanks

gary305 07-28-2011 07:04 PM

Re: fishing shadow lake middletown- what baits/lures to use
 
Have gone there a few times and have had some luck with chatreuse spinnerbaits in the middle and texas rigged watermelon candy yum worms 5"
lucky you can get out there because the water is so low around the floating docks

DDDman 07-28-2011 10:50 PM

Re: fishing shadow lake middletown- what baits/lures to use
 
Have not fished there in about 6 years but I used to do great tossing a grape 4inch french fry worm and a baby 1 minus crankbait. I wanted to try the lake again but the low water prevents me from getting my boat in there. I can't wait until they dredge the place.

Jerseydix 08-04-2011 06:30 AM

Re: fishing shadow lake middletown- what baits/lures to use
 
Small boat fishermen have this lake all to themselves. Just have to push pole a hundred yards or so from the boat launching area. It's loaded with fish, nice sized ones too. I've always done well with shallow running cranks and sluggo type lures here.

ChaosStarter 08-04-2011 08:15 AM

Re: fishing shadow lake middletown- what baits/lures to use
 
My buddy and I have fished it twice this year, once two weeks ago and about1.5 months ago. It was a great day 2 months ago. However, we went 2 weeks ago, and not only is it very weed choked, but it was a very brown murky color which was surprising because it hadn't rained for a couple days.

We didn't get a thing two weeks ago and the only hits we had we a splash up around a frog on mats, and my buddy had 2 hits on a orange/black bug. That was about it. Definately a good spring spot.
